⚡ 4:1 Ag/Pd Solderable Termination for MLC Capacitors
MacDermid Alpha Micromax 4999 is a solderable 4/1 silver/palladium termination paste designed for multilayer ceramic capacitors. Featuring Pb/Cd/Ni/phthalate-free formulation, 710-750°C firing, and carrier plate-type dipping with good solderability and adhesion over a wide range of capacitor bodies per TDS specifications.

Micromax 4999 is a solderable 4/1 silver/palladium termination paste designed for multilayer ceramic capacitors. This cadmium-free and lead-free termination offers good solderability and high adhesion over a wide range of capacitor bodies. The paste is ideal for applications where platable terminations are not desired but where soldering conditions are required. It is optimized for carrier plate-type dipping applications with a viscosity of 50-68 Pa.s per TDS specifications.

With a solid content of 75-77%, Micromax 4999 is applied by dipping and dried using a belt dryer at 140-160°C for 15-20 minutes. The paste fires at 710-750°C peak with a 40-minute cycle and 5-10 minute peak hold. The composition is compatible with ceramic capacitor bodies and delivers reliable solderability and adhesion. Full Technical Specifications

Property Typical Value TDS Reference
Product Type Ag/Pd termination paste TDS: Ag/Pd termination
Application MLC capacitors / Termination TDS: Termination
Packaging Specification Standard container
Metallurgy Ratio 4:1 Ag/Pd TDS: 4/1 silver/palladium
Solid Content 75-77% TDS: 75 to 77 %
Viscosity (Brookfield RVT 10 rpm) 50-68 Pa.s TDS: 50 to 68 Pa.s
Application Method Carrier plate-type dipping TDS: carrier plate-type dipping
Application Temperature 21-25°C TDS: 21°C – 25°C
Mixing (Alternative) Slow jar rolling for 24 hours TDS: 24 hours
Drying Peak Temperature 140-160°C TDS: 140 – 160°C peak
Drying Cycle 15-20 min TDS: 15 – 20 minute cycle
Firing Peak Temperature 710-750°C TDS: 710°C – 750°C peak
Firing Cycle 40 min TDS: 40 minute cycle
Peak Hold Time 5-10 min TDS: 5-10 minutes at peak
Firing Atmosphere Air (oxidizing) TDS: air, oxidizing
Substrate Compatibility Ceramic capacitor bodies TDS: ceramic capacitor bodies
Thinner Micromax 8218 TDS: 8218
Shelf Life 6 months TDS: 6 months
Storage Temperature 5-30°C TDS: 5-30°C

Handling and Storage Recommendations

Storage Rules Store in tightly sealed containers in clean, stable environment at 5-30°C. TDS: 5-30°C
Shelf Life 6 months in unopened containers from date of shipment. TDS: 6 months
Pre-use Preparation Thoroughly mix prior to use. Some settling may occur during storage. TDS: thoroughly mix
Thinning Not normally required; use Micromax 8218 thinner sparingly for evaporative losses. TDS: 8218
